Summary
Vibrations of a stiffened annular sector plate with arbitrary boundary conditions are analysed using the spline element method. The plate is idealized as a system of an annular sector plate and curved beams rigidly connected to each other. To demonstrate the accuracy of the present method several examples are solved, and the results are compared with those obtained analytically and by other numerical methods. Good accuracy is obtained. The effect of stiffening beams on the frequencies of stiffened annular sector plates is also investigated.
